Advertisement

第十一届蓝桥杯电子类国赛一等奖代码

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:RAR


简介:
这段代码是作者参加第十一届蓝桥杯全国软件和信息技术专业人才大赛电子类比赛并获得国赛一等奖的作品,展示了其卓越的技术能力和创新思维。 第十一届蓝桥杯电子类国赛中获得了一等奖。感觉今天的比赛题目非常简单,就像某届省赛的难度一样。三个小时内完成了所有题目的代码编写,并且实现了所有的功能需求。现在分享我的代码给大家,请在转载时注明出处。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• 优质
    这段代码是作者参加第十一届蓝桥杯全国软件和信息技术专业人才大赛电子类比赛并获得国赛一等奖的作品,展示了其卓越的技术能力和创新思维。 第十一届蓝桥杯电子类国赛中获得了一等奖。感觉今天的比赛题目非常简单,就像某届省赛的难度一样。三个小时内完成了所有题目的代码编写,并且实现了所有的功能需求。现在分享我的代码给大家,请在转载时注明出处。
  • 单片机省二场
    优质
    这段代码是作者在参加第十一届蓝桥杯单片机竞赛第二场比赛中获得一等奖的作品,展现了其卓越的技术能力和创新思维。 第十一届蓝桥杯单片机省赛第二场的省一代码完美实现了题目要求的功能。这是我在比赛期间编写的代码,由于时间紧张,比赛中没有添加注释,赛后也懒得补充了,但代码结构清晰易懂。
  • 单片机——及全部试题
    优质
    本资源包含第十一届蓝桥杯全国软件和信息技术专业人才大赛电子类单片机组国赛一等奖源代码,以及该赛事所有官方试题,适合参赛选手学习参考。 第十一届蓝桥杯电子类国赛已经结束,我在比赛中获得了一等奖。感觉今天的比赛题目非常简单,难度甚至接近以往的省赛水平。我仅用了三个小时就完成了所有题目的编程,并且实现了所有的功能要求。赛后直接将代码整理了出来,现在分享给大家,请在转载时注明出处。
  • 嵌入式省
    优质
    这段内容是第十一届蓝桥杯全国软件和信息技术专业人才大赛中嵌入式设计与开发类别省级比赛所使用的试题代码。包含了竞赛时选手需要完成的各项编程任务。 本项目包含题目和代码,感兴趣的可以下载查看。程序编写得较为简单,便于阅读,并且所有功能均已实现。PWM输出采用定时器中断方式,精度达到题目要求。
  • 2020年JavaB组
    优质
    2020年第十一届蓝桥杯Java国赛B组是面向全国高校大学生举办的一项高水平编程竞赛活动,旨在促进计算机学科教育发展和提升学生实践能力。 蓝桥杯全国软件和信息技术专业人才大赛由工业和信息化部人才交流中心主办,包括北京大学、清华大学在内的全国31个省市自治区的1200多所院校参与其中,每年参赛人数超过30000人。
  • 真题
    优质
    本书收录了第六届至第十一届蓝桥杯全国软件和信息技术专业人才大赛的历年真题,涵盖C/C++程序设计与Java软件开发等多个科目。适合相关专业的学生及程序员参考练习。 本段落档包含了第六至十一届蓝桥杯比赛的真题,适合对蓝桥杯、数据结构和算法感兴趣的小伙伴们学习使用。
  • 优质
    这段内容是关于第十四届蓝桥杯全国软件和信息技术专业人才大赛的省级比赛中的编程题解与参赛代码分享,旨在帮助学习者理解和提高编程技能。 【蓝桥杯】是一项全国知名的软件与信息技术专业竞赛,旨在培养和选拔优秀的IT人才,在编程和嵌入式系统领域尤其突出。第十四届蓝桥杯省赛代码为参赛者提供了展示技能的平台,通过比赛可以提升对编程语言的理解、熟练掌握常用函数的应用,并锻炼实际问题解决能力。 文中提到有备注版本是指代码中包含注释,这对学习和理解代码逻辑至关重要。良好的注释能够帮助读者快速了解每个函数的功能、参数及返回值,提高代码的可读性和维护性。对于嵌入式系统开发而言,熟悉使用函数是基础,因为通过调用封装了特定功能的函数可以高效实现系统功能,并减少重复编码。 在【压缩包子文件名称列表】中我们可以看到以下关键部分: 1. `G2021102220.ioc`:可能是工程配置文件,记录项目的设置信息如编译器选项、库链接等。这类文件通常由集成开发环境(IDE)生成以保存项目状态。 2. `.mxproject`:这可能是一个基于Mbed OS或Keil μVision的项目文件,在Keil IDE中常见扩展名为`.mxproject`,用于存储配置、构建规则和依赖关系的信息。 3. `Drivers`:这个目录包含驱动程序代码。驱动程序作为硬件与软件间的桥梁,使操作系统或其他应用能够控制设备如串口、GPIO等。 4. `Core`:可能包括核心库或系统级别的代码,这些通常涉及系统的运行机制如任务调度和内存管理。 5. `bsp`(Board Support Package的缩写)代表板级支持包。这是特定硬件平台初始化代码及驱动集合,使操作系统或应用程序能够在该硬件上顺利运行。 6. `MDK-ARM`:是ARM微控制器开发工具套件简称,通常包括编译器、调试器等其它开发工具如Keil uVision,广泛应用于ARM架构的嵌入式系统开发中。 综上所述: 1. 在嵌入式领域里掌握函数使用基础能够帮助开发者快速实现所需功能。 2. 注释是提高代码质量的关键因素之一,有助于理解与维护代码。 3. 不同项目文件和目录代表着嵌入式开发的不同阶段及内容,如配置、驱动程序、核心库以及硬件支持包等。 4. 使用类似Keil μVision的IDE可以更方便地管理和构建嵌入式系统项目。而驱动程序和板级支持包则是连接软硬件的关键部分。 5. 参加蓝桥杯比赛能够为参赛者提供实践及提升编程与问题解决能力的机会,通过实际操作来增强技能水平。